Output 3898dc8730923c2e1266f51faf03b78cffcbcd1d9bd9c2055357249a856a0f8e:1

value
28550468605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2c0d0e34bb0b05a1862d3e0c1498637e1834e58 OP_EQUAL
address
2N85nSSz67qUMvwVYQcpYq96iSZX6BhaaKZ
transaction
3898dc8730923c2e1266f51faf03b78cffcbcd1d9bd9c2055357249a856a0f8e